As part of Home Care and Hospice's quality improvement program, this position is responsible for reviewing nursing documentation practices and providing feedback to obtain more complete documentation that will accurately reflect the patient's clinical presentation and the individualized plan of care. The Clinical Documentation Specialist will complete concurrent chart reviews on admissions, communicate with the clinicians and coding specialists, and analyze data. The Clinical Documentation Specialist will also prepare and present clinician education sessions to improve documentation practices.
Position Qualifications:
Minimum Education Must be a Registered Nurse with a current license in the State of Indiana and a Bachelor of Science degree in Nursing.
Minimum Experience 1 to 2 years' experience in Hospice or Home Care.
Preferred Experience Previous Plan of care review experience.
Certifications Preferred Oasis, CHPN
